The contribution margin of the Man's Store for the month of November 2019 is shown below:
Man's Store
Contribution Margin Income Statement
November 2019
Sales Revenue P60,000
Variable Expenses:
Cost of goods sold P22,000
Selling 13,000
Gen. and Administrative 7,000 42,000
Contribution margin P18,000
Fixed Expenses:
Selling P11,000
Gen. and Administrative 3,000 14,000
Operating income P4,000
The company sells two of ties for every belt. The ties sell for P7, with a variable expense of P4.90 per unit. The belts sell for P6, with a variable unit cost of P4.20.
Required:
Problem 1. Determine the Man's Store monthly breakeven point in the number of ties and belts. Prove the correctness of your computation by preparing a summary contribution margin income statement at breakeven. Show only two categories of expenses: variable and fixed
Problem 2. Compute for the margin of safety in pesos.
Problem 3. Suppose that the company increases monthly sales by 15% above the P60,000. Compute for the operating income.
Problem 4. Suppose the company expand the store and increases monthly fixed expenses by P4,800. Use the contribution margin approach to determine the new breakeven sales in pesos.
